如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

BabelJS REPL:前端开发者的必备工具

BabelJS REPL:前端开发者的必备工具

在前端开发领域,BabelJS 是一个不可或缺的工具,它将现代JavaScript代码转换为可以在旧版浏览器中运行的代码。今天,我们将深入探讨 BabelJS REPL,一个在线工具,它不仅能帮助开发者快速测试和转换代码,还能提供许多实用的功能。

什么是BabelJS REPL?

BabelJS REPLBabel 官方提供的一个在线交互式环境。REPL 是 Read-Eval-Print Loop 的缩写,意味着你可以输入代码,立即看到转换后的结果。它的主要功能包括:

  • 代码转换:将ES6+的代码转换为ES5或其他目标环境支持的代码。
  • 语法高亮:提供代码的语法高亮显示,方便阅读和调试。
  • 错误提示:当输入的代码有语法错误时,REPL会给出详细的错误信息。
  • 插件支持:可以使用Babel的各种插件来定制转换过程。

如何使用BabelJS REPL?

使用 BabelJS REPL 非常简单:

  1. 访问网站:打开浏览器,访问 BabelJS REPL
  2. 输入代码:在左侧的输入框中输入你想转换的JavaScript代码。
  3. 选择预设和插件:根据需要选择Babel的预设(如@babel/preset-env)和插件。
  4. 查看结果:右侧会显示转换后的代码。

BabelJS REPL的应用场景

BabelJS REPL 在以下几个方面特别有用:

  • 学习和教学:对于学习JavaScript新特性的开发者来说,REPL提供了一个直观的学习环境,可以实时看到代码转换的结果。
  • 快速测试:开发者可以快速测试代码片段,查看转换后的效果,避免在本地环境中反复配置。
  • 调试和优化:当遇到代码转换问题时,REPL可以帮助快速定位和解决问题。
  • 团队协作:团队成员可以共享REPL链接,共同讨论和优化代码转换策略。

BabelJS REPL的优势

  • 无需安装:无需在本地安装Babel环境,直接在线使用。
  • 即时反馈:输入代码后立即得到转换结果,提高开发效率。
  • 灵活配置:可以根据项目需求选择不同的预设和插件。
  • 社区支持:Babel社区活跃,REPL的功能也在不断更新和完善。

相关工具和资源

除了 BabelJS REPL,还有其他一些工具和资源可以帮助开发者更好地使用Babel:

  • Babel CLI:用于命令行操作的Babel工具。
  • Babel Standalone:可以在浏览器中直接使用Babel的库。
  • Babel Playground:另一个在线Babel测试环境。
  • Babel Handbook:官方手册,详细介绍Babel的使用和配置。

总结

BabelJS REPL 作为一个在线工具,为前端开发者提供了一个便捷的环境来测试和转换JavaScript代码。它不仅简化了开发流程,还提供了丰富的功能来支持开发者的日常工作。无论你是初学者还是经验丰富的开发者,BabelJS REPL 都是一个值得探索和使用的工具。通过它,你可以更深入地理解JavaScript的转换过程,提高代码的兼容性和可维护性。

希望这篇文章能帮助你更好地了解和使用 BabelJS REPL,在前端开发的道路上更进一步。

promotion